引言
随着科技的飞速发展,旅游行业正经历着前所未有的变革。低代码开发作为一种新兴的技术,正逐渐改变着旅游体验的方方面面。本文将探讨低代码开发如何助力旅游行业创新,提升用户体验,并分析其带来的机遇与挑战。
低代码开发概述
低代码开发(Low-Code Development)是一种可视化的软件开发方法,通过拖拽组件、配置参数等方式,降低了对传统编程语言和开发技能的依赖。这种方法使得非技术背景的开发者也能参与到软件开发过程中,极大地提高了开发效率和灵活性。
低代码开发在旅游行业的应用
1. 个性化旅游服务
低代码平台可以帮助旅游公司快速搭建个性化旅游服务系统。通过分析用户数据,系统可以为游客提供定制化的旅游路线、住宿推荐和活动安排。
// 示例代码:生成个性化旅游路线
function generateTourRoute(userPreferences) {
// 根据用户偏好生成旅游路线
// ...
return route;
}
2. 智能预订系统
低代码开发可以用于构建智能预订系统,实现实时价格比较、预订确认和取消等功能。通过集成地图服务和天气预报,系统还能为用户提供实时的旅行信息。
# 示例代码:智能预订系统
def bookTravelPackage(packageDetails, travelerInfo):
# 预订旅行套餐
# ...
return bookingConfirmation;
3. 游客互动体验
低代码平台可以快速开发游客互动应用,如虚拟导游、在线问答和社交分享等。这些应用可以提升游客的旅行体验,并促进旅游景点的宣传。
<!-- 示例代码:虚拟导游界面 -->
<div id="virtualGuide">
<!-- 导游信息、景点介绍等 -->
</div>
低代码开发带来的机遇
1. 加速创新
低代码开发降低了开发门槛,使得旅游企业能够快速响应市场变化,推出创新产品和服务。
2. 提升效率
通过自动化流程和可视化界面,低代码开发可以显著提高开发效率,降低人力成本。
3. 优化用户体验
个性化服务和智能化的旅游体验可以提升游客的满意度,增强品牌忠诚度。
低代码开发带来的挑战
1. 技术依赖
过度依赖低代码开发可能导致企业对技术平台的依赖性增加,一旦平台更新或更换,可能面临技术迁移的难题。
2. 安全性问题
低代码开发平台的安全性需要得到保障,以防止数据泄露和恶意攻击。
结论
低代码开发为旅游行业带来了新的机遇,通过个性化服务、智能预订系统和游客互动体验等方面的应用,有望重塑旅游体验。然而,企业在采用低代码开发时,也需要关注技术依赖和安全性等问题,以确保其可持续发展。